Abstract

A 56-year-old male was diagnosed as right lower pharynx carcinoma by upper gastrointestinal endoscopy gastrointestinal endoscopy, and underwent endoscopic laryngo-pharyngeal surgery to resect the lesion. The iodine-unstained area was suspected of being cancerous and was also resected. The resected area may adhere to surrounding tissues, which may affect the patient's swallowing function in the future. Local injection of triamcinolone acetonide to the desquamated site to prevent adhesions did not result in stenosis during postoperative follow-up.
